The Tesla Powerwall represents a groundbreaking advancement in home energy storage technology, seamlessly integrating with solar panel systems to provide reliable and sustainable power solutions. This cutting-edge battery system stores excess solar energy generated during daylight hours for use during nighttime or cloudy periods, effectively reducing dependency on the traditional power grid. The Powerwall features a sleek, compact design that can be wall-mounted either indoors or outdoors, making it adaptable to various home configurations. With a usable capacity of 13.5 kWh and 100% depth of discharge, it delivers consistent power output while maintaining optimal efficiency. The system includes advanced monitoring capabilities through the Tesla app, allowing homeowners to track energy usage, storage levels, and system performance in real-time. The Powerwall's intelligent software automatically detects grid outages and transitions to backup power within a fraction of a second, ensuring uninterrupted power supply to essential home appliances. Additionally, its weather-resistant construction and liquid thermal management system ensure reliable operation across diverse climate conditions, while the 10-year warranty provides long-term peace of mind for homeowners investing in sustainable energy solutions.

The Tesla Powerwall offers numerous compelling advantages that make it a smart investment for homeowners seeking energy independence. First, it significantly reduces electricity bills by storing excess solar energy for use during peak rate periods, effectively maximizing the financial benefits of solar panel systems. The system's ability to provide backup power during grid outages ensures household resilience, maintaining power to critical appliances and systems when conventional power sources fail. The Powerwall's smart energy management features enable automated optimization of energy usage, drawing from stored power during high-rate periods and charging during low-rate times. Its scalable design allows multiple units to be installed in parallel, accommodating varying energy needs and future expansion. The system's quiet operation and zero direct emissions contribute to a more sustainable living environment, while its sophisticated monitoring capabilities give users unprecedented control over their energy consumption. The Powerwall's integration with Tesla's solar roof and panels creates a comprehensive energy ecosystem, maximizing efficiency and self-sufficiency. Its minimal maintenance requirements and robust construction ensure long-term reliability, while the system's ability to participate in virtual power plants can provide additional revenue streams through energy sharing programs. The Powerwall's automatic updates and remote troubleshooting capabilities minimize downtime and ensure optimal performance throughout its lifespan.

Advanced Energy Management System

The Tesla Powerwall's sophisticated energy management system represents a breakthrough in home energy control. The system employs artificial intelligence and machine learning algorithms to optimize energy usage patterns, automatically adjusting to household consumption habits and weather forecasts. This intelligent system can predict peak usage periods and prepare accordingly by ensuring sufficient energy storage. The Powerwall's Time-Based Control feature enables automated switching between grid and stored power based on electricity rates, maximizing cost savings. The system's Storm Watch feature monitors weather forecasts and automatically reserves energy capacity when severe weather threatens grid reliability. Through the Tesla app, users gain access to detailed energy monitoring tools, including real-time power flow visualization, historical usage data, and predictive analytics for future energy needs.

Superior Backup Power Capability

The Powerwall's backup power capabilities set new standards in residential energy security. During grid outages, the system's rapid switching mechanism activates in less than 20 milliseconds, ensuring seamless power transition that protects sensitive electronics and maintains continuous operation of critical systems. The Powerwall can support multiple days of backup power when paired with solar panels, providing extended autonomy during prolonged outages. Its intelligent load management system prioritizes essential appliances, extending backup duration by optimizing energy distribution. The system's high power output capability of up to 7kW continuous and 10kW peak ensures reliable operation of high-demand appliances, while its parallel configuration options allow for increased power capacity to meet diverse household needs.

Environmental and Economic Benefits

The Tesla Powerwall delivers substantial environmental and economic advantages that position it as a leading solution for sustainable living. By enabling greater utilization of solar energy, the system significantly reduces household carbon footprints and dependence on fossil fuel-based grid power. Users typically experience 30-90% reduction in grid electricity consumption, translating to substantial long-term cost savings. The system's participation in utility demand response programs can generate additional income through energy arbitrage opportunities. The Powerwall's role in reducing peak grid demand helps stabilize local power networks and decrease the need for fossil fuel peaker plants. Its contribution to home value appreciation, combined with various available tax incentives and rebates, enhances the overall return on investment. The system's long operational lifespan and minimal maintenance requirements further strengthen its economic benefits.
